> I am trying to get Samba to connect to a LDAP server.  I am using Samba 3.
> When I start Samba, the following error is in the smbd.log:
> 
> [2004/02/22 16:53:10, 2] lib/smbldap.c:smbldap_search_suffix(1066)
>   smbldap_search_suffix: searching for:
> [(&(objectClass=sambaDomain)(sambaDomainName=IS))]
> [2004/02/22 16:53:10, 0] lib/smbldap.c:smbldap_open_connection(530)
>   ldap_initialize: Time limit exceeded

> Does anyone have a resolution to this problem?

You never correctly contacted to the LDAP server.  Try with command-line
tools, and debug it from there.
